XTNDER the provisions of Section ij 93 of the Mines Act 1877, the Dunedin Company (Limited), h AAj makes application for a Specfay fflaim, of one mile in . length, of/the bed of the Rive/ Molyneux, between Alexandra South and Mutton Town Point, as pegged out for dredging for gold, adjoining its present Special Claim on its upper or Northern end, and extending therefrom in a noitherly direction one mile, being so much of the river course as was surveyed on behalf of Scott and party in the year 1881. And the Company applies under circumstances involving the expend! ture of considerable sums of money, the Company’s dredge having cost £6OOO, and steadily employing about ten men. Dated this thirteenth day of November, 1883. THE DUNEDIN GOLD DREDGING CO (LIMITED.) By its Solicitor and Agent, F. J. Wilson. Hearing at Alexandra South at 11 a.m., on 3rd December, 1883.
